The Software Development Life Cycle (SDLC)

The software development life cycle is a framework that outlines the stages involved in developing software. It typically includes:

  • Planning: Defining the scope and purpose of the project.
  • Requirements Analysis: Gathering detailed requirements from stakeholders.
  • Design: Creating system architecture and design specifications.
  • Coding: Writing the actual code for the application.
  • Testing: Ensuring that the software functions as intended through various tests.
  • Deployment: Releasing the software to users or production environments.
  • Maintenance: Updating and fixing issues as they arise post-deployment.

What are the 4 types of developers?

In the world of software development, the question of “What are the 4 types of developers?” often arises. While the categorization may vary depending on perspectives, some common classifications include front-end developers, back-end developers, full-stack developers, and mobile app developers. Front-end developers focus on creating user interfaces and experiences using technologies like HTML, CSS, and JavaScript. Back-end developers work on server-side logic and databases to ensure applications function smoothly behind the scenes. Full-stack developers possess skills in both front-end and back-end development, allowing them to work on all aspects of an application. Mobile app developers specialize in creating applications for mobile devices, utilizing platforms like iOS or Android to deliver seamless user experiences on smartphones and tablets. Each type of developer plays a crucial role in bringing software projects to life and contributing to the digital landscape’s diversity and innovation.

Is software Dev harder than web dev?

The question of whether software development is harder than web development is a common one in the tech industry. While both fields require a strong foundation in programming and problem-solving skills, they differ in their focus and complexity. Software development typically involves creating standalone applications or systems that run on various platforms, requiring a deep understanding of algorithms, data structures, and software architecture. On the other hand, web development focuses on building websites and web applications that interact with users through browsers, emphasizing knowledge of front-end technologies like HTML, CSS, and JavaScript. Ultimately, the difficulty of each field can vary based on individual preferences, project requirements, and the specific challenges encountered during development.
